About

"Crayon Chronicles" is a short, action-packed RPG with randomly generated levels, encouraging multiple playthroughs to rescue kidnapped friends from the tyrannical Lord Stratolustrious. The "Heroic Hallitorium" keeps track of interesting facts about each playthrough, allowing for comparison with friends' adventures. Brave the Swampyards, defeat Strato, and rescue your friends for glory and a well-deserved rest.

  • Cute graphics and a unique crayon drawing style that appeals to both kids and adults.
  • Simple mechanics make it accessible for beginners to the roguelike genre, while still providing a challenge.
  • Low price point offers good value for a short, entertaining gameplay experience.
  • Lack of replayability due to fixed map layouts and no progression between playthroughs.
  • Clunky interface and heavy reliance on mouse clicking for movement and actions can be frustrating.
  • Strong RNG elements can lead to unfair deaths, making the game feel more luck-based than skill-based.
  • graphics
    21 mentions Positive Neutral Negative

    The graphics of the game are characterized by a charming, crayon-drawn aesthetic that appeals to both children and adults, creating a colorful and accessible visual experience. While some users appreciate the nostalgic and unique art style, others note issues such as pixelation and a lack of resolution options, which can detract from the overall presentation. Despite these criticisms, the graphics are generally well-received for their cuteness and engaging design, contributing positively to the game's appeal.
